For just 3 nodes, you might just use GRE.

NHRP provides the capability that spoke IPs can be dynamic.

DMVPN provides encryption.

DMVPN rides over mGRE but if you don't need NHRP or encryption (or per hub to spoke QoS [or dynamic shaping]), don't see why you couldn't just use mGRE.

DMVPN is a very useful, flexible and scaleable tunneling technology where you can build a dmvpn tunneling cloud from simple hub and spoke topology to a multi tier complex hup and spokes topologies and it can be used with IPSec encryption for security and confidentiality but IPSec is optional but highly recommended

Ok ba k to the usage of this technology bellow are some examples where you can use it

- back up to the private WAN to be used over Internet for example

- if a customer has only Internet and with hub and many spokes and the spokes obtain their ip from the ISP not static then with dmvpn each spoke will register with the hub and the hub the will know about the spoke ip to be used as next hope for routing

-curry multi cast and routing traffic

- if a customer use it as main or back up method and they have VoIP dmvpn the best option here as with VoIP you will need direct RTP traffic between endpoints and this will be done by using the dmvpn spoke to spoke or branch to branch direct traffic

- if a customer have WAN network and they want to secure the ip communicatio. Over the WAN then DMVPN with IPSec encryption can be used and on top of it the routing can be run
